    Munoz’s Late Goal Secures Colombia’s Spot in World Cup Round of 32

    In a crucial Group K encounter, Daniel Munoz delivered a decisive goal in the 76th minute to propel Colombia to a narrow 1-0 victory against DR Congo. This win was pivotal as it guaranteed Colombia’s advancement to the round of 32 in the ongoing World Cup tournament. The match showcased Colombia’s tactical discipline and resilience, allowing them to maintain a clean sheet while capitalizing on a key scoring opportunity.

    Colombia’s progression marks a significant milestone in their World Cup campaign, reflecting the team’s consistent performance in the group stages. DR Congo, despite their efforts, were unable to break through Colombia’s defense, highlighting the competitive nature of the group. This result sets the stage for Colombia’s next challenge in the knockout rounds, where the stakes and intensity are expected to rise considerably.

    Notably, Munoz’s goal not only secured the win but also underscored his importance to the national squad during high-pressure moments. The victory adds momentum to Colombia’s World Cup journey and boosts morale among players and supporters alike. As the tournament advances, Colombia will aim to build on this success and make a deeper run in the competition.
